The mountain-biking MB Race at the Portes du Mont Blanc

The 10th edition of the MB Race, the most difficult mountain biking race in the world, will take place on the Portes du Mont Blanc, from July 5 to 7, 2019.

The setting chosen for the 10th edition of this exceptional mountain bike event includes Combloux, Megève, La Giettaz, Cordon and Sallanches, all with Mont Blanc as a backdrop.

Despite its level of difficulty, the event remains open to all audiences (children, adults, beginners or experts) with seven events available for viewing: MB Ultra, MB Explore, MB e-Rando, MB Enduro, MB First, MB Kids and MB Draisienne. On the occasion of the 10th edition, the MB Race will celebrate the “finishers,” the participants, the volunteers and the staff who made the event a success and continue to develop it.

Among the new features, the MB First (20 KM/12.4 miles) will be open to everyone from 15 years old and up, and will allow younger cyclists to discover the atmosphere that reigns on the mythical trails of the MB Race!

The MB Explore (35 km/21.7 miles | 55km/35.2 miles) is a challenge in its own right, including 50 km (31 miles) of mountain biking through breathtaking landscapes facing Mont Blanc!

In the “classics” the mythical MB Ultra (70 km/43.5 miles | 100 km/62.1 miles km | 140 km/87 miles) takes place on the trails of Mont Blanc, dropping 7000 m (22965 ft) in altitude drop over 140 km (87 miles) for participants who will have only one objective: become “finisher” of the most difficult race in the world!

The MB Enduro (with five “Specials”) is a one-day race running the old-fashioned way, where piloting and technique are put in the spotlight.

With the MB E-rando (35 km/21.7 Miles | 55 km/43.5 Miles), the MB Race also knows how to make discover its mountain biking trails that delight lovers of beautiful routes.

The young competitors from 7 to 14 years old also have their race, the MB Kids, open to the MB finishers of tomorrow! Highlight of the weekend, the little ones have fun on a loop in the heart of the exhibitors' village!
